Output 99edbbdb703c029514f1f0ec8832f7ea0e1a449d57609642156eee0c44c58aea:1

value
103324
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e9d8f188f2f3d3cdd606782ea15771ed43e65983 OP_EQUAL
address
3P1VFjntMPGDqQiwzBbmnpm4V4YTUeZR6F
transaction
99edbbdb703c029514f1f0ec8832f7ea0e1a449d57609642156eee0c44c58aea
confirmations
313717
spent
true